Bankhouse care home in Lanark celebrates “Good” inspection

We are delighted to announce that Bankhouse Care Home in Lesmahagow, Lanark has been awarded “Good” ratings in all evaluated areas, including Support, Leadership, Staff Team, and Setting, during its latest unannounced inspection by the Care Inspectorate. This achievement underscores the care home’s dedication to excellence and its success in providing a nurturing and supportive environment for older people.

Highlights from the Inspection Report

The inspection report provided glowing feedback across various areas:

  • Resident and Family Satisfaction: Feedback from residents and their families emphasised the high level of care and support provided at Bankhouse. One family member expressed, “I could not ask for better care. They [staff] phone about any changes and are very good to him [relative]. He seems very happy here.”
  • Wellbeing and Activities: The inspection highlighted the individualised care approach and the rich activities programme tailored to resident preferences, promoting community connections and personal fulfilment.
  • Leadership and Staff: The report praised the leadership and the skilled, caring staff team for their motivation and commitment to continuous improvement and training.

A Remarkable Improvement

Achieving “Good” ratings across the board is a significant milestone for Bankhouse, as the service was previously ranked as adequate in certain areas. This remarkable improvement is a testament to the dedicated efforts of the entire team.
